Is NameCheap a Russian company?
Namecheap is an ICANN-accredited domain registrar and technology company founded in 2000 by CEO Richard Kirkendall. It is one of the fastest-growing American companies according to the 2018 Inc.

Which hosting is cost effective?
Shared Hosting. Shared hosting is the most basic type of web hosting. It’s cost-effective and the best choice for small or entry-level websites. As the name implies, websites using shared hosting will be sharing resources with other websites on a single server.

Is namecheap owned by ENOM?
Domain name registrar Namecheap is big, but until this year it didn’t show up on charts that rank registrars by domains. That’s because Namecheap acted as an Enom reseller, so it added to Enom’s numbers rather than its own.

What is Namecheap’s CDN?
Namecheap’s free content delivery network (CDN) plan includes basic DDoS protection, custom SSL upload, and a traffic limit of 50 GB per month. Paid plans are also available with more advanced features. Turn back time and protect your website data with AutoBackup.
